Output eab603dddf07b288f4b9a9d905978757e1eacf2426af66fbfb771091dc0a667f:53

value
705831
script pubkey
OP_0 OP_PUSHBYTES_20 58e7b035967dc8623b213969885c7aa39e07ec68
address
bc1qtrnmqdvk0hyxywep895cshr65w0q0mrgtjt67w
transaction
eab603dddf07b288f4b9a9d905978757e1eacf2426af66fbfb771091dc0a667f
spent
true